Tara Jane O'Neil

Having first made a name as the bassist in the Louisville avant-garde art punk band Rodan in the early-1990s, songwriter Tara Jane O’Neal was already a compelling indie-rock world when she began her solo career in 2000. Beginning with a bathroom-recording that transformed into her debut album, the meditative Peregrine (2000 Quarterstick), the multifarious artist is not only a versatile instrumentalist, but she is also a visual artist (her solo albums feature her own paintings as covers and she’s had two books of art published), film and theater scorer as well as an accomplished studio engineer.
